Out-of-school rate for adolescents and youth of lower and upper in Sierra Leone
Sierra Leone: Out-of-school rate for adolescents and youth of lower and upper was 0.6121 GPIA in 2023. ▼ Falling
Out-of-school rate for adolescents and youth of lower and upper in Sierra Leone, 2013–2023
Source: UNESCO Institute for Statistics. Measured in GPIA.
Analysis
Sierra Leone recorded 0.6121 GPIA for out-of-school rate for adolescents and youth of lower and upper in 2023. That is the lowest value across all 10 years on record.
The figure is down 23.0% on the previous year and down 43.1% over ten years.
Over the whole period, out-of-school rate for adolescents and youth of lower and upper in Sierra Leone peaked at 1.07 GPIA in 2013 and was at its lowest, 0.6121 GPIA, in 2023.
That places Sierra Leone 156th out of 175 countries with data for 2023, putting it in the bottom quarter.
The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 10 years of available data.
Out-of-school rate for adolescents and youth of lower and upper in Sierra Leone, year by year
| Year | GPIA | Change |
|---|---|---|
| 2013 | 1.07 GPIA | — |
| 2015 | 1.02 GPIA | -4.8% |
| 2016 | 1.01 GPIA | -1.1% |
| 2017 | 0.9897 GPIA | -2.2% |
| 2018 | 1.02 GPIA | +2.6% |
| 2019 | 1.01 GPIA | -0.4% |
| 2020 | 0.9832 GPIA | -2.8% |
| 2021 | 0.94 GPIA | -4.4% |
| 2022 | 0.795 GPIA | -15.4% |
| 2023 | 0.6121 GPIA | -23.0% |
Sierra Leone compared with similar countries
- Sierra Leone's 0.6121 GPIA is below the median for low income countries, which is 0.9676 GPIA, 63% of the median. (16 countries reporting)
- Sierra Leone's 0.6121 GPIA is below the median for Sub-Saharan Africa, which is 0.9365 GPIA, 65% of the median. (34 countries reporting)
